Clonmacnoise Monastery is over 1500 years old and is one of Irelands most important historic sites. The site is an impressive mixture of the ruins of a cathedral, seven churches, two round towers, three high crosses and a large collection of Early Christian grave slabs. The River Shannon (Irish: Abhainn na Sionainne, an tSionainn, an tSionna), at 360.5 km (224 miles) in length, is the longest river in the British Isles. The River Shannon is also linked to Lough Erne in County Fermanagh in Northern Ireland via the Shannon-Erne Waterway; this makes it possible to cruise between the North and South of Ireland. You can spot flocks of traditional water birds such as heron, swan, Mallard Duck and Tufted Duck, along with kingfishers fishing on the lough, pheasant roaming around the grasslands and numerous jays flying to and fro.
